James Hiram Massey 1860–1938 – Genealogical Records

Birth Date: 14 November 1860

Birth Location: South Carolina, United States of America

Death Date: 9 Apr 1938

Death Location: Rome, Floyd County, Georgia, United States of America

Father: Major Massey

Mother: Elizabeth O'Shields

Spouse(s): Artie Windsor

Children(s): George Sr

The story of James Hiram Massey began in 1860 in South Carolina, United States of America. In 1900, James Hiram Massey resided in Vans Valley, Floyd, Georgia, USA. In 1910, James Hiram Massey resided in Mud Creek, Cherokee, Alabama, USA. James Hiram Massey married Artie Bell Windsor, and had children including George Boston Massey Sr. James Hiram Massey passed away in 1938 in Rome, Floyd County, Georgia, United States of America.
